Alexa Rank measures several things including traffic rank, sites linking in a traffic rank in the US. On the surface of it this sounds great but where does it get its ranking from? Does Alexa rank benefit your SEO?

Where Does Alexa Get Its Ranking Position From?

So far so good, Alexa ranking sounds great! But Alexa rankings come from the Alexa toolbar which their customers install into their browsers, and it tracks their activity around the Internet.
